Tricky means are deceitful, crafty, or skillful.

In Tagalog, it can be translated as “MAPANLINLANG” or “NAKALILITO.”

Here are some example sentences using this word:

  • The tricky question about his finances discomfited the minister.
  • Decorating a teenager’s bedroom can be tricky.
  • Confidence was shown to exceed achievement only when knowledge questions are overly difficult and tricky.
  • The chess player was surprised at the tricky move during the game when his opponent then said, “Checkmate!”
  • Finding the best sunscreen for kids and babies can be tricky, as every child may have different reactions to certain ingredients, consistencies or application methods.

In Tagalog, the aforementioned sentences could be translated as:

  • Ang nakakalito na tanong tungkol sa kanyang pananalapi ay nagpagulo sa ministro.
  • Ang pagdekorasyon sa kwarto ng isang teenager ay maaaring nakakalito.
  • Ang kumpiyansa ay ipinakita na lumampas lamang sa tagumpay kapag ang mga tanong sa kaalaman ay masyadong mahirap at nakakalito.
  • Nagulat ang chess player sa mapanlinlang na hakbang sa laro nang sabihin ng kanyang kalaban, ang salitang “Checkmate!”
  • Ang paghahanap ng pinakamahusay na sunscreen para sa mga bata at sanggol ay maaaring nakakalito, dahil ang bawat bata ay maaaring magkaroon ng iba’t ibang mga reaksyon sa ilang mga sangkap, pagkakapare-pareho o mga paraan ng paggamit.
